The ingredients needed to make Ube/taro cup cake:

  1. Make ready 2 cups cake flour
  2. Take 3/4 cup room temp unsalted butter
  3. Take 1 1/4 cup granulated sugar
  4. Take 1 tsp baking soda
  5. Prepare 1/2 tsp baking powder
  6. Make ready 1 cup fresh milk
  7. Get 1 tbsp white vinegar
  8. Prepare 7 drops ube/taro flavoring
  9. Make ready 1 cup cooked purple yam. or ube jam

Instructions to make Ube/taro cup cake:

  1. Mix the flour, baking powder, baking soda. Set aside.
  2. Make the butter cream by mixing the 1cup of milk and a 1tbsp of vinegar (mix)and leave for 10mins. Set aside.
  3. Mix the butter using hand or stand mixer for 5 min until fluppy, the add sugar gradually then mix again, then add the ube jam mix again then gradually add our butter cream mixture alternately with flour mixture until we finish the butter cream and flous mixture, beat until well combined.
  4. The pre heat the oven 160 deg celcius
  5. Prepare you desired moulder then pour the mixture.
  6. Bake for 30 mins until done.
  7. I just add grated cheeze on top coz my son love it. Its optional.
  8. You can also used whipping cream or butter cream for toppings.. Enjoy!

Ube cake is a traditional Filipino chiffon cake or sponge cake made with ube halaya (mashed purple yam). It is distinctively vividly purple in color, like most dishes made with ube in the Philippines. Ube cake is generally prepared identically to mamón (chiffon cakes and sponge cakes in Filipino cuisine).
